It works by increasing phospho creatine stores in the body, which helps with energy and stamina at the gym, as well as muscle hydration, but you have to take it every day to reach a saturation point enough to get benefit from it, the average for most is 5g per day, but some can benefit from higher doses,
Some morons, including formerly me, say that it can cause hair loss because it increases dht levels in the body, but there's never actually been proof that causes hair loss, there is one paper, but it's origins are erroneous at best and downright false at worst,
At the end of the day give it a shot, it definitely can help you even if just a placebo,
Tldr: Cheap and helps stamina so it good

Have you actually read the study? They were taking 20 grams a day and only ONE of the players developed MPB and they never even factored genetics into the study.
Yes I have read the study. 20 grams isn’t unreasonable for a loading phase, you should just pee out the excess anyway. What’s worrying isn’t that one guy literally got bald, tbh I don’t even remember that part, it is the huge spike in serum DHT without a corresponding change in free test. That implies that creatine is doing something to prevent or slow the breakdown of DHT into other compounds. That excess DHT is what could cause hair loss if you’re genetically predisposed, a 56% spike in DHT is fricking huge, considering finasteride only reduces production by 60-70%

Very disingenuous wording and conclusion in that study.
1. The results of van der Merwe have not been replicated because no other published study has tested for DHT in conjunction with creatine supplementation. The authors word it in weaselly a way that implies that other studies did not detect a spike in dht
2. Intense resistance exercise can cause elevated androgenic hormones, sure, but these were already trained athletes. That increase should already be accounted for in baseline DHT levels
3. They suggest that creatine might be up regulating the production of DHT, but that this would be unlikely because increases in total test are not associated with creatine. The conclusion is that creatine is therefore unlikely to cause a DHT spike, when in reality a more reasonable conclusion is that creatine is slowing down or down regulating the breakdown of DHT, leading to higher levels despite total test remaining the same
4. Calling a 0.55 nmol/L spike in DHT “small” is not objective wording and deliberately downplays it. They also suggest that the lower baseline level in the control group somehow explains why the spike was “statistically significant” but offers no real analysis or statistical comparison other than just not so subtly implying that the result is wrong
5. [various authors on the study] “has received funding to study creatine and is an advisor for supplement companies who sell creatine”. This is literally a shill study

You have a massive misconception about what bloating and water retention is. When your muscles have water and bloating, they look full and strong, not soft. When models prep for a shoot, they eat tons of carbs right before and work out a bit to get a pump. They also dehydrate. The carbs pull all the water they have left into the muscles and into the pump, while leaving none to the skin. That makes the muscles look crazy big, full, and hard, while the dehydrated skin clings to the muscles and veins.
Tldr: creatine and water makes your muscles look full and hard, not soft. Like a wiener engorged with blood. Mmmmmm.

Not a miracle product. Nothing is. It has been clinically shown to increase both performance and muscle growth. The only downside is you retain more water (so you weight a bit more). As long as you drink plenty of water and don't need to make weight for some weight class competition, there's absolutely no downside.
That being said, we're talking about something like a 5% difference. It won't make or break your progress. If you're fat and depressed, it won't cure that. Only hard work will. Creatine just makes you 5% faster.
